Short Stories for the Young and Old
Short Stories for the Young and Old was created almost entirely from the author's imagination. There are two Christmas stories in this book. One is about a tree that wanted to be a Christmas tree, but it seemed to have a hard time. The second is about a lost decoration that was very important to a little girl. After talking it over with my husband, the author decided Pixie may want to be part of another story. So in this story, Pixie is a detective! This gives her another responsibility, outside of being a service dog and guide protector.
The last story in this book is primarily for older readers. It is a mystery story, partially based on fiction, but mostly on an unbelievable experience the author had. Enjoy!
